The Hobbit for the ZX Spectrum: a text adventure with interactive NPCs from 1982

After having a Lord of the Rings and The Hobbit movie marathon this weekend, I fired up a ZX Spectrum emulator and relived playing the text adventure game The Hobbit. I shared some screenshots in this thread on Twitter here:

The Hobbit was released in 1982 for the ZX Spectrum. For it’s time, it has some interesting features, like NPCs that wandered around, and language parsing of statements allowing you to interact with the NPCs, like ‘say to Elrond “read map”‘.

Given the unusual (for the time) ability to interact with the NPCs, there even exists a ZX Spectrum emulator specifically to play The Hobbit, which also shows the state of the interactive characters and objects in the game as you play. This is well worth taking a look at to get an insight into how the game works – quite an achievement for an 8 bit game in only 48k:

